A white hole is the theoretical "other end" of a black hole- things that go into a black hole come out this way. However, the gravitational effects at the singularity in the center of the hole are otherwise the same (and anyone making the trip would be crushed without some form of protection). It would be almost indistinguishable from a black hole.
